HR Development Manager Location: Walton-on-the-Hill, Tadworth. Hybrid – 3 days office / 2 days home Salary: £50,000 - dependant on experience (paid 4-weekly) benefits We are looking for an experienced HR Development Manager to lead the development, implementation and continuous improvement of our people development initiatives. Working closely with senior leaders in a fast-paced, multi-customer environment, you will identify skills gaps, strengthen succession pipelines and drive initiatives that enhance leadership capability and long-term workforce development. You will also play a key role in ensuring our business remains compliant with emerging employment legislation. What you’ll be responsible for You will play a lead role in designing and delivering development strategies that translate organisational goals into an effective people development plan. You will lead the implementation of new employment legislation, updating policies, guidance and training materials to ensure full compliance and minimise organisational risk. You will take ownership of key HR development projects including capability frameworks, talent development initiatives and succession programmes. You will shape and deliver training strategies, designing and delivering training solutions to enhance skills, strengthen capability and support operational excellence. You will partner with leaders to identify current and future skills gaps, building targeted development interventions and robust succession plans across all business units. You will oversee and continuously improve succession planning cycles, ensuring continuity of critical roles and supporting leaders to nurture internal talent. You will coach and mentor managers, helping to strengthen people leadership, performance management and employee engagement. You will use organisational data to analyse development needs, recommending organisational development (OD) improvements and measuring impact. You will develop and embed HR policies, procedures and programmes related to training, development, talent management, performance and succession. You will collaborate closely with HR Advisors, ensuring they grow capability and gain wider exposure to HR development practices. You will build strong, trusted relationships with senior leaders, managers and key stakeholders to influence decisions and drive a culture of continuous development. Key Relationships Senior leadership and key stakeholders Divisional & Department Managers People Team & wider HR team Talent Acquisition Team Support Office Functions Health & Safety The impact you’ll have In this role, you will translate people development strategy into practical, high-impact programmes that improve capability, morale, productivity and retention across the business. Translate development and people strategies into deliverable programmes and ensure adherence to core processes. Maintain up-to-date knowledge of current and upcoming employment legislation and emerging HR trends, ensuring business compliance and training managers accordingly. Work with leaders to improve capability, build morale, and increase productivity and retention through structured development programmes. Lead and manage critical programmes including talent management cycles, succession planning and capability projects. Operate effectively within a multi-customer environment, balancing differing needs while delivering high standards of service. What we’re looking for We’re looking for a confident HR professional who enjoys working in a fast-paced environment and making a visible impact. Experience operating at HRBP or HR Development Manager level Strong background in fast-paced, multi-site or multi-customer environments Solid understanding of current and upcoming UK employment legislation Experience designing, managing and delivering people development projects CIPD Level 5 qualified (or working toward) Comfortable working in a hybrid pattern – 3 days in the office, 2 days from home About You Not Specified About Us What we will give you £50,000 salary (dependant on experience) paid 4-weekly 25 days holiday bank holidays Life Assurance Private Medical Cover Wagestream Eligibility for company bonus scheme
